TC Group Announces Hyundai Auto Sales Results for September 2024: A Significant 39.3% Month-over-Month Growth

Hyundai Accent retains its top-selling position in September with 1,290 units sold, marking a 37.7% growth compared to August. The Hyundai Creta follows closely behind with 1,068 units, an impressive 74.2% increase. The recently launched Hyundai Santa Fe also performs well, recording sales of 758 units, a 48.3% month-over-month growth.

The Hyundai Grand i10 takes fourth place with 561 units sold, an 81% increase from August. The Hyundai Tucson comes in fifth with 495 units, a 16.5% growth, while the Hyundai Venue secures sixth place with 482 units, a notable 62.3% increase. The Hyundai Stargazer rounds off the top seven with 433 units, a 14.9% improvement.

Hyundai Custin records 302 units sold, placing eighth and showing a 39.2% growth. The Hyundai Elantra comes in ninth with 179 units, a 35.6% increase, while the Hyundai Palisade completes the lineup with 163 units, a significant 59.8% month-over-month growth.

Hyundai’s commercial vehicles also performed well, with a total of 777 units sold in September, a 2.5% increase from August. This includes 70 units of the Hyundai Mighty LT 2.5-ton and Hyundai Solati exported to overseas markets.
